Direct Flights from Gatwick to Prestwick
As of the latest information available, there are no direct flights from London Gatwick Airport (LGW) to Glasgow Prestwick Airport (PIK). Prestwick Airport, located in South Ayrshire, Scotland, primarily serves a limited number of destinations, with a focus on low-cost carriers and seasonal routes. Historically, direct flights between Gatwick and Prestwick have been sporadic and often dependent on airline schedules and demand.
If you are specifically looking for direct flights from Gatwick to Prestwick, it is essential to check with airlines that operate from both airports. In the past, airlines like Ryanair have offered direct routes between London airports and Prestwick, but these services have been subject to change. Ryanair, for instance, has previously flown from London Stansted (STN) to Prestwick, but not from Gatwick. Therefore, it is crucial to verify current schedules directly with airlines or through reliable travel booking platforms.
For travelers seeking to fly from London to Prestwick, alternative options are available. London Stansted Airport is the most common London airport with direct flights to Prestwick, typically operated by Ryanair. If Gatwick is your preferred departure point, you may need to consider connecting flights or alternative routes. For example, flying from Gatwick to Glasgow International Airport (GLA) and then traveling to Prestwick by ground transportation could be a viable option.

Luton Airport Connections to Prestwick
For travelers looking to fly from London to Prestwick, understanding the available connections is crucial. While Prestwick Airport (PIK) in Scotland is primarily served by a limited number of airlines, Luton Airport (LTN) in London does not currently offer direct flights to Prestwick. However, there are practical ways to connect between the two destinations, combining flights with other modes of transport for a seamless journey.
Flight Options from Luton Airport:
From Luton Airport, travelers can fly to Glasgow International Airport (GLA), which is the closest major airport to Prestwick. Airlines such as easyJet and Ryanair operate regular flights from Luton to Glasgow. The flight duration is approximately 1 hour and 15 minutes, making it a convenient first leg of the journey. Once in Glasgow, passengers can proceed to Prestwick using ground transportation options.
Ground Connections to Prestwick:
After arriving at Glasgow Airport, the most straightforward way to reach Prestwick is by train. The journey from Glasgow Central Station to Prestwick Airport Station takes around 45 minutes, with frequent services available. Travelers can use the airport bus service (the 500 Glasgow Airport Express) to reach Glasgow Central Station from the airport, which takes about 15 minutes. Alternatively, taxis or car rentals are available for those preferring a more direct route.

Seasonal Flights from Heathrow to Prestwick
While a direct search reveals that London Stansted (STN) is the primary London airport offering flights to Glasgow Prestwick Airport (PIK), it's important to note that Heathrow Airport (LHR) does not currently offer direct seasonal or year-round flights to Prestwick.
Here's a breakdown of why and what your options are:
Understanding the Route: Prestwick Airport primarily serves low-cost carriers and charter flights. Heathrow, being a major international hub, focuses on global connections and doesn't typically cater to regional UK routes, especially those served by budget airlines.
Seasonal Flight Dynamics: Seasonal flights often operate during peak travel periods like summer holidays. While there might be occasional charter flights from Heathrow to Prestwick during these times, they are not regular or guaranteed.
Alternatives from Heathrow: If you're set on flying from Heathrow, consider these options:
- Connect through another UK airport: Fly from Heathrow to Glasgow International Airport (GLA) or Edinburgh Airport (EDI) with airlines like British Airways or Virgin Atlantic, then take a connecting flight or ground transportation to Prestwick.
- Explore other London airports: As mentioned, London Stansted offers direct flights to Prestwick with Ryanair. This is the most straightforward option for this particular route.
